This is a petition to keep Synchronized Swimming a varsity sport at the University of Alabama at Birmingham. Recently the Athletics Department at UAB has decided to cancel the already existing program. Why keep Synchronized Swimming you ask This is why: - UAB Synchro has been the highest nationally ranked sport on campus since its inception seven seasons ago. - We own three third-place finishes and three fourth-place finishes at the Collegiate National Championships, and a fourth and three fifth-place finishes at the US National Championships. - We have produced nine All-Americans - more than any other team on campus, according to the 2008 UAB Synchronized Swimming media guide, a UAB publication. - We have also produced 15 Academic All-Americans, and have maintained one of the athletic department\'s highest team GPAs. Many people are confused as to why the decision was made to cut the program. It is the understanding of the athletes that there are two main reasons: - UAB is a Conference USA school, and Synchronized Swimming is not currently a Conference USA Sport. - UAB would like a team that brings in more female athletes in order to comply with Title 9, an NCAA rule that states that there must be as many female athletes on athletic scholarships as there are males. It has been brought to my attention that a rumour has been circulating that the NCAA has cancelled Synchronized Swimming. This is untrue. The NCAA is re-evaluating USA Synchro in July, but A DECISION HAS NOT BEEN MADE. Therefore this is not a justification to cancel the program. Also I would like to make you aware that all other programs in the country are at risk, and that if UAB looses their varsity status, this will reflect poorly to the NCAA. It may be the end the National Synchronized Swimming Collegiate System. We have a good following at the University - we fill out the entire seating area at Bell Aquatics Center every year for our single home meet of the season. We would host more competitions, but no one will come to our pool because a routine that is not designed for shallow water like ours is not doable in our facility.
